On Thu 05-07-12 02:44:55, Johannes Weiner wrote:
> Once charged, swapcache pages can only be uncharged after they are
> removed from swapcache again.
>
> Do not try to uncharge pages that are known to be in the swapcache, to
> allow future patches to remove checks for that in the uncharge code.
